About Juan J. Moragues
Juan J. Moragues is a scholar working on Civil and Structural Engineering, Building and Construction and Earth-Surface Processes, having authored 28 papers that have together received 510 indexed citations. Recurring topics across this work include Construction Engineering and Safety (10 papers), Structural Behavior of Reinforced Concrete (9 papers) and Structural Engineering and Vibration Analysis (6 papers). The work is most often cited by research in Civil and Structural Engineering (448 citations), Building and Construction (278 citations) and Earth-Surface Processes (64 citations). Juan J. Moragues has collaborated with scholars based in Spain, Colombia and Germany. Frequent co-authors include José M. Adam, Pedro A. Calderón, Manuel Buitrago, Elisa Bertolesi, Juan Sagaseta, Salvador Ivorra, Ester Giménez, Joaquín G. Ruiz-Pinilla, Benjamín Torres and Yezid A. Alvarado. Their work appears in journals such as IEEE Transactions on Signal Processing, Construction and Building Materials and Engineering Structures.
